On average across the year,
yes, Tunisia is hotter than
Amherst, New York
.
Tunisia has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F and Amherst, New York has an average temperature of 10°C/50°F.
Tunisia's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F, which is hotter than Amherst, New York's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 28°C/82°F).
On average across the year, no, Tunisia is not colder than Amherst, New York . Tunisia has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F and Amherst, New York has an average minimum temperature of 5°C/41°F.
On average across the year,
no, Tunisia has less rain than
Amherst, New York. Tunisia has an average annual rainfall of 290mm and Amherst,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1167mm.
Tunisia's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 41mm, which is drier than Amherst, New York's wettest month (also October, with an average monthly rainfall of 144mm).
